Esmeralda Xochitl Flores is an experienced professional specializing in program management, community engagement, and event coordination. Since January 2020, Esmeralda has served as the Senior Program Activities Specialist and Equity Coordinator at the Los Angeles County Office of Education. Previous roles include self-employed Wedding Coordinator and Officiant, Group Facilitator, and consultant for several educational organizations, including the Partnership for Los Angeles Schools and We the People Public High School. Esmeralda also held positions as a Census Field Supervisor with the U.S. Census Bureau and Operations Manager at The Broad Center. With a strong educational background, including a Master's in Communication Studies from San Francisco State University and various professional development certificates, Esmeralda combines expertise in strategic planning, team building, and community engagement.

The Los Angeles County Office of Education (LACOE) is the nation’s largest regional education agency. We provide a range of programs and services to promote the academic and financial stability of the county’s 80 school districts and the achievement of more than 2 million preschool and school-age children.
